Purpose. In recent decades, there has been an increased interest in the study of the prevention of cardiovascular diseases in civil aviation dispatchers, for whom professional stress is one of the leading risk factors in the formation of arterial hypertension in the workplace. Material and methods. The article presents the survey data of 120 civil aviation dispatchers, who, in order to reduce the prevention of the development of arterial hypertension, underwent a complex of combined color-light-and psycho-correctional music therapy. Conclusion. As a result of the study, it was proved that the combined color-light therapy technology and psycho-correctional music therapy have a pronounced vasocorrecting effect, which is confirmed by a decrease in systolic and diastolic pressure and heart rate to the level of healthy individuals in the studied contingent of air traffic controllers.
